HDFS-4043. Namenode Kerberos Login does not use proper hostname for host
qualified hdfs principal name (#4785)
Use the existing DomainNameResolver to leverage the pluggable resolution
framework. This provides a means to perform a reverse lookup if needed.
Update default implementation of DNSDomainNameResolver to protect against
returning the IP address as a string from a cached value.
